Accommodations often involve adjustments to when a student can access an assessment and how much time they have to complete it. Crowdmark supports two main approaches to handling these types of accommodations:
- Customizing settings for individual students: Best for situations where all students begin the assessment at the same time, but some require different time limits, due dates, or late penalties.
- Duplicating the assessment for specific students: Best for when a student needs to complete the assessment at a different time than the rest of the class (e.g., due to a scheduling conflict or formal accommodation). This allows you to set a separate release time and, for timed assessments, a different time window.
This guide focuses on the first option and covers how to apply student accommodations (such as adjusting due dates, time to complete, or lateness penalties) within an Assigned Assessment.

1. Access Crowdmark assessment

- In your Crowdmark course, select the assessment you would like to change accommodations for.
2. Access student's submission status

- Select Students option on the left-hand side navigation menu
- Search for a student in the search bar you would like to create accommodation for or find them in the student list
- Once you have located the student, under the column Status select either Viewed or Not viewed. This status notes if a student has taken any actions towards that assessment.
Setting accommodations for multiple students: To set accommodations for multiple students, Crowdmark now allows you to apply them in bulk at the individual assessment level for Assigned assessments. To learn how, refer to the step-by-step guide: Accommodation options for assigned assessments.
3. Customize due date

- Check off Customize due date under Accommodation Options
- Add a new date and time for the specific student's submission
- Select Save button to save the adjusted accommodation.
Course-Level Accommodations: If students require consistent accommodations across all assessments, you can now apply course-level accommodations, either individually or in bulk. This allows you to set custom due dates or time extensions that automatically apply to all future assessments for those students. These accommodations can be configured on a per-student basis and will be reflected in each new Assigned Assessment they receive. See the full guide: Course accommodations.
